Trip Summary
There is usually just one train option from Fullerton to Victorville per day. The average train journey from Fullerton to Victorville takes 2 hours and 16 minutes, though some trains might be a few minutes slower or faster.
Distance | 58 mi (94 km) |
Fastest train | 2h 16m |
Lowest price | $18.00 |
Trains per day | 1 |
Most frequent service | Amtrak Southwest Chief |
Train lines | 1 |

Which train should you take from Fullerton to Victorville?
Amtrak Southwest Chief is the one and only train line which connects Fullerton to Victorville. Furthermore, there is only one train per day, so you will have to plan your travel around this limited availability. On the other hand, you won't have to spend a ton of time comparing a bunch of possible options.
Train | Daily Trips | Avg. Time | Avg. Price |
---|---|---|---|
Amtrak Southwest Chief | 1 | 2h 16m | $27.45 |
The Southwest Chief is a passenger train operated by America’s largest train service, Amtrak. The full route travels over 2,200 miles from Chicago to Los Angeles, which takes over 43 hours. The train covers the stretch from Fullerton to Victorville in about 2 hours and 16 minutes. In addition to standard Coach Class seats, the Southwest Chief offers several sleeper cabin options on longer journeys. Amtrak’s Southwest Chief is consistently ranked as one of the most scenic train routes in America, thanks to the stunning views of the Painted Desert, the Red Cliffs of Sedona, and the Grand Canyon you’ll see from your train window.

City Information
Fullerton
Fullerton was founded in 1887 and is roughly 22 miles from Los Angeles. The area around Fullerton was the original California orange growing zone due to its great Mediterranean environment. The nightlife in downtown Fullerton is well-known, plus there are around 50 parks in the city, including the famed Fullerton Arboretum, which features 26 acres of uncommon and rare species as well as sculpted gardens.
Fullerton has some of the best art museums in the country, including Muckenthaler Art and Cultural Center and the Clayes Performing Arts Center. You can also experience amazing lakes such as the Laguna Lake Park.
If you're a beer-lover, visit the Bootleggers Brewery. Founded in 2008 by home brewer and beer enthusiast Aaron Barkenhagen, Bootleggers Brewery is one of Orange County's largest artisan breweries.
As for transportation, Amtrak and Fullerton Metrolink are the two best train stations in Fullerton serviced by Amtrak's Southwest Chief and Pacific Surfliner. These Amtrak lines connect from Los Angeles, Bakersfield, and even as far away as Chicago. For buses, Amtrak Thruway comes from Santa Ana, Bakersfield, Los Angeles, and Riverside to Fullerton. The nearest airport is Long Beach Airport, which is only 14 miles away from the city.
Victorville

Victorville is popularly known as a stop along the famous Route 66 in the Mojave Desert. The city was as a filming site for some of your favorite films, like Face/Off, Lethal Weapon, and Kill Bill: Volume 2. Victorville is home to the California Route 66 Museum and has other art, culture, and historic locations. Families can check out the different parks and activity centers, like the Mojave Narrows Regional Park, which features camping sites and fishing, and the Scandia Family Fun Center. Golf lovers in Victorville can check out the Green Tree Golf Course.
One of the best aspects of Victorville is the food scene, with some popular locations being the Pancho Villa's Mexican Restaurant and Emma Jean's Holland Burger Café. Downtown Victorville is the best part of the city for food. The High Desert Farmers' Market is always bustling with shoppers, and Victorville is home to different breweries and taprooms. The Victorville Fall Festival is a highlight in the city, offering a street fair experience for all ages.
Victorville is easy to access by train and bus from tens of other cities. Trains going to Victorville are powered by Amtrak, while FlixBus US provides the bus routes in the area. There are also public bus routes within the city.
